Epidemic Vs. Pandemic — What’s The Difference?
Epidemic Vs. Pandemic — What’s The Difference? ‘epidemic’ vs. ‘pandemic’ an epidemic is an outbreak of disease—that is, sudden localized incidence of a disease—that spreads quickly and affects many individuals at the same time. a pandemic is a type of epidemic, one with greater range and coverage. "epidemic" and "pandemic" are two words that describe the spread of disease. "epidemic" is used to describe a disease that has grown out of control and is actively spreading. "pandemic" is used to describe a disease that affects a whole country or the entire world. 1.

What are the differences between pandemics and epidemics? the who defines pandemics, epidemics, and endemic diseases based on a disease's rate of spread. thus, the difference between an epidemic and a pandemic isn't in the severity of the disease, but the degree to which it has spread. When a disease spreads unexpectedly throughout a geographical region, it’s an epidemic. when a disease spreads to multiple countries and continents, it’s considered a pandemic. One of the main differences between an epidemic and a pandemic is the scale of impact and the geographical reach of the disease. while epidemics are typically more localized and contained within specific regions, pandemics have a global reach and affect a much larger population. Epidemic and pandemic are just two of the words used frequently in news stories about the disease. they're not the same thing. What's the difference between epidemic and pandemic? epidemic and pandemic are used to describe widespread outbreaks of a disease, but there are subtle differences between the two words. An epidemic involves the wide ranging spread of a disease throughout an entire area or particular community where it’s not permanently prevalent. a pandemic involves an even wider spread, often reaching across the entire world.
